> > > > There are many memcmp calls in ld.so. I think most, if not all, of them
> > > > can be changed to __memcmpeq. Can you make another patch to do
> > > > that?
> > >
> > > Rather than doing that micro-optimization in the glibc sources, I think
> > > it's better to add the relevant feature to GCC and let glibc get optimized
> > > when built with a new-enough compiler.
> >
> > Why not? We don't know when __memcmpeq will be supported by GCC
> > used by glibc developers. If we don't even use it in glibc, why bother?
>
> The point of this function is entirely for compilers to generate for calls
> from memcmp, not for humans to write direct calls to.
>
> The compiler knows other semantics of memcmp (it might sometimes expand a
> memcmp with a small fixed size inline, for example). So changing to a
> direct call to __memcmpeq by hand isn't even always an optimization; it
> seems better to leave the semantics visible to the compiler. Note that in
> other cases we've generally moved *towards* relying on built-in functions
> rather than having our own local inline expansions of those or calls to
> internal names for those functions (we've done that for calls to various
> functions in libm, for example).
I have gone through all non-test .c files in GLIBC and replaced memcmp
with __memcmpeq where it makes sense. I can post that as a separate
patchset and we can decide whether it's a good idea there.
